On Tue, Apr 19, 2016 at 7:32 AM, Samuele Disegna <[email protected]> wrote: > Yes! There is a multidimensional array that enables indexing of the > smaller port (or the ability to have byte enables). > Yes that will be a problem :( There are a couple options: first, try and rework the example without the multidimension array. Second, you could use the user defined code and wrap the template. That would probably be the fastest and you would be able to still model the same logic in myhdl just not convert the multidim array.
